You can go to an automotive locksmith who is Subaru-certified to get a new key fob or yours is damaged or lost. They can cut and program your new key at a lower cost than going to the dealer. They will require your VIN (Vehicle ID Number) to verify they have the right key for your vehicle.

Some Subaru keys do not need to be programmed, while others require a specific machine that only the dealer or an automotive locksmith can access. This is why it is crucial to be aware of the year, make and model of your vehicle to find an auto locksmith or dealer that is knowledgeable about this type of vehicle.

The loss of a car key can be a stressful situation for the owner. But fortunately, replacing the Subaru key is simple and affordable. Numerous locksmiths for automotive can replace your car's key fob without the need for a dealership.

The first step is to determine the kind of key you have. There are two kinds of keys such as transponder chips or non-transponder keys made of metal. The former requires a specific programer that only the locksmith or dealer can use. The second is a basic key made of metal that does not require any programming.

The next step is to locate locksmiths who can cut and program the key. Go to their website and see whether they have any reviews or recommendations.
